UCI Travels to UCSB, Hosts Pepperdine

Nov. 10, 2009

'EATERS TRAVEL TO UCSB, HOST PEPPERDINE: Coach Marc Hunt's UC Irvine men's water polo team (14-9 overall, 2-3 MPSF) is in fifth place in the league entering a pair of games this weekend.

The `Eaters travel to UC Santa Barbara Saturday (Nov. 14) for a 12 noon game and host Pepperdine Sunday in the home finale at 2:00 p.m.

Pepperdine is in sixth place in the MPSF with a 2-4 mark and UCSB is seventh at 1-4.

UCI closes out regular-season play Nov. 21 at USC.

The MPSF Tournament is at USC Nov. 27-29.

FINAL HOME GAME FOR SIX SENIORS: Sunday's game against Pepperdine marks the final home appearance for UCI seniors Cole Bielskis, Greg Enloe, Erik Evered, James Frank, Tom Kruip and Harvey Newland. They will be recognized during the pre-game starting lineups.

`EATERS DROP TWO AT HOME: UCI lost two home games Sunday, 12-5 to Stanford in an MPSF contest and 10-9 in overtime to Concordia in a non-conference game.

Senior Tom Kruip led UCI with two goals against Stanford while senior goalkeeper Erik Evered recorded 13 saves versus the Cardinal.

Junior Kyle Kruip scored three goals in the loss to Concordia. UCI went up 9-8 with 2:31 remaining in regulation but the Eagles scored a goal with 1:24 left in the fourth quarter and then won the game in overtime.

James Frank and Brandon Johnson added two goals each for UCI.

SCORING LEADERS: Cole Bielskis leads the team in scoring with 40 goals with Tom Kruip following with 39. They rank seventh and eighth in the MPSF in scoring with averages of 1.74 and 1.70 goals per game, respectively.

Brandon Johnson has 35 goals and he ranks 14th in MPSF scoring average at 1.52 goals per game.

Greg Enloe has scored 27 goals, James Frank 23, Kyle Kruip 18, Trent Baxter 11 and Griffin Lerman 10.

IN GOAL: Junior Matt Johnson has started 20 games and has 139 saves. Senior Erik Evered has played in seven games with three starts and has recorded 42 stops.
